見出し画像

【徹底比較】ChatGPT vs Azure OpenAI Serviceどちらを導入すべき?違いや選ぶポイントを解説

近年、AIのテキスト生成技術が急速に進化し、その波に乗る企業や開発者が増えています。特に注目を集めているのが、OpenAIの「ChatGPT」とMicrosoftの「Azure OpenAI Service」です。これらのサービスは、先進的な自然言語処理技術を背景にしているため、多くのビジネスシーンでの利用が期待されています。しかし、社内導入においてどちらを選ぶべきか、その違いや選ぶポイントを把握し適切に判断をする必要があります。この記事では、両者の特徴を比較し、「ChatGPT」と「Azure OpenAI Service」のどちらを導入すべきかの選定ポイントを紹介します。

ChatGPTとは

ChatGPTは、自然言語処理の分野で革新的な成果を上げているOpenAIによって開発された、会話型AIモデルです。このツールは、テキストベースのインタラクションを通じて、ユーザーの質問やコメントに対して自然で流暢な返答を提供します。

ChatGPTの基本機能

ChatGPTの最大の特徴は、その高度な会話能力にあります。自然な言葉遣いで応答し、さまざまな質問に対して適切な情報を提供する能力を持っています。また、文脈を理解し、会話の流れをスムーズに保つことができるため、ユーザーにとって非常に使いやすいです。

ChatGPTの応用事例

ChatGPTはAPIを活用すれば幅広くカスタマイズできるため、カスタマーサポート、コンテンツ生成、教育、エンターテインメントなど、多岐にわたる分野で応用されています。例えば、FAQの自動応答や、学習支援ツールとして利用することができます。

ChatGPTの利用環境

ChatGPTの専用Web画面から基本的な利用が可能です。OpenAIが提供しているAPIを活用することで、Webベースのアプリケーションや、組み込みシステム、さまざまなデバイス上で利用することもできます。

Azure OpenAI Serviceとは?

Azure OpenAI Serviceは、MicrosoftのクラウドプラットフォームAzure上で提供されるAIサービスで、OpenAIの先進的な言語モデルを活用しています。このサービスは、企業がAIを利用したアプリケーションを容易に開発し、デプロイすることを可能にします。

Azure OpenAI Serviceの基本機能

Azure OpenAI Serviceの主な機能は、テキスト生成、言語理解、自然言語処理です。これにより、ユーザーはカスタマイズ可能なAIモデルを使用して、独自のアプリケーションやサービスを作成できます。また、Microsoftのクラウドインフラストラクチャのセキュリティとスケーラビリティの恩恵を受けることができます。

Azure OpenAI Serviceの応用事例

このサービスは、BI、カスタマーサービス、コンテンツ生成など、多様な業務で利用されています。特に、大規模なデータ処理や分析が必要な場合に強みを発揮します。

Azure OpenAI Serviceの利用環境

Azure OpenAI Serviceは、Microsoft Azureのクラウド環境に完全に統合されています。これにより、様々なAzureサービスとの連携性、セキュリティ、運用管理体制の面での優位性があります。

両者の違いとは?

ChatGPTとAzure OpenAI Serviceは、表面上は似ているように見えますが、いくつかの重要な違いがあります。これらの違いを理解することは、どちらのサービスを選択するかを決定する上で重要です。

機能面での違い

ChatGPTは主にテキストベースの会話に焦点を当てており、ユーザーとの対話を通じて情報を提供します。一方、Azure OpenAI Serviceはより広範な機能を提供し、テキスト生成、言語理解、自然言語処理など、より多様なアプリケーション開発に利用できます。しかしChatGPTでは「GPTs」機能を利用することができるため、より簡単にオリジナルのAIを作成することができます。

コスト面での違い

ChatGPTは、比較的低コストで利用できることが多く、小規模なプロジェクトや個人ユーザーに適しています。一方で、Azure OpenAI Serviceは企業向けに設計されており、大規模なデプロイメントや高度なカスタマイズを必要とする場合に適していますが、それに伴うコストも高くなる傾向にあります。

実装とメンテナンスの違い

ChatGPTの導入とメンテナンスは比較的シンプルで、多くの場合、APIを通じて容易に統合できます。一方、Azure OpenAI ServiceはMicrosoft Azureエコシステム内で動作するため、導入とメンテナンスにはより専門的な知識が必要となる場合があります。

どちらを選ぶべき?選ぶポイントを解説

ChatGPTとAzure OpenAI Serviceのどちらを選択するかは、用途や予算に大きく依存します。以下に、選択する際の重要なポイントを挙げます。

用途に応じた選択

もし、主にテキストベースのやりとりや、テキストの生成のみを必要とする場合、ChatGPTが適している可能性が高いです。対話型エージェントやFAQシステム、簡単なコンテンツ生成に最適です。一方、Azure OpenAI Serviceは、カスタムAIモデルの開発や大規模なデータ処理が必要なビジネスアプリケーションに向いています。

コストとリソースのバランス

予算とリソースの制約がある場合、ChatGPTの低コストかつ簡易な統合は魅力的な選択肢となります。大規模なビジネスや、カスタマイズとスケーラビリティが重要なプロジェクトには、Azure OpenAI Serviceが適しているでしょう。

将来性とサポート体制

将来的な拡張や長期的なサポートが必要な場合、MicrosoftのAzure OpenAI Serviceが提供する安定したインフラとサポート体制が有利です。一方で、短期的なプロジェクトや、迅速なプロトタイピングが求められる場合は、ChatGPTの柔軟性が重宝されます。

セキュリティとリスク管理

セキュリティ面での懸念がある場合、Azure OpenAI Serviceが優勢と言えます。AIの学習制限やAzure上でアクセス制限など、セキュリティリスクを技術的に抑えるだけでなく、利用ログを辿ることも可能なので、何か問題が発生した場合の対処もスムーズに行うことができるでしょう。

おススメ

まずはお試しで比較的安価であるChatGPTの導入をおすすめします。ChatGPTを社内で十分に活用できると判断できた場合、今後のスケールを考えAzure OpenAI Serviceに切り替えると良いでしょう。
しかし、前述したとおり、ChatGPTはセキュリティやリスク管理の面では比較的優れてはいません。そのため入力データがAIの学習に使われないようにオプトアプトの申請や、社内生成AI利用規約などを整備すると良いでしょう。

導入するなら

弊社ではChatGPTやAzure OpenAI Serviceのような生成AIの社内導入支援を行っております。特に、APIを使用する場合やAzureの環境構築には専門的知識が必要です。また、導入後の活用方法や業務改善についても承りますので、お気軽にお声がけください。

株式会社Launch Base
担当 代表取締役 武居功祐
お問い合わせフォーム:https://forms.gle/JrWvSJ49kYZ8hecg9

まとめ

ChatGPTとAzure OpenAI Serviceは、それぞれに独自の強みを持ち、異なる用途に最適化されています。最終的な選択は、用途、予算、技術的要件に基づいて慎重に行うべきです。この記事が、両者の機能と特性を理解し、最適な選択をするための一助となれば幸いです。

この記事が気に入ったらサポートをしてみませんか?